批量反序列化漏洞检测——保障网络安全的必备之举
近年来,互联网技术迅速发展,我们的生活和工作已经离不开网络。然而,随着互联网的普及和应用,网络安全问题也日益凸显。其中,批量反序列化漏洞是一种经常被黑客利用的安全漏洞。本文将为大家介绍什么是批量反序列化漏洞,以及如何进行有效的漏洞检测,提升网络安全防护能力。
首先,我们来了解一下什么是批量反序列化漏洞。在计算机程序中,序列化是指将对象转换为字节流的过程,而反序列化则是将字节流重新还原为对象的过程。而批量反序列化漏洞就是指黑客通过对程序进行篡改,使得在反序列化过程中引入恶意代码,从而实现攻击目标。
那么,为什么批量反序列化漏洞那么危险?其原因主要有两点。首先,批量反序列化漏洞具有潜在的跨平台性,即攻击者可以通过构造恶意的序列化数据包来攻击不同的操作系统和编程语言。其次,由于反序列化过程通常会在内存中创建对象实例,攻击者可以利用这个特性来实现远程代码执行,从而进一步控制服务器或数据泄露。
为了解决批量反序列化漏洞带来的威胁,漏洞检测显得尤为重要。那么,如何进行有效的漏洞检测呢?
首先,合理选择漏洞检测工具是至关重要的。目前市场上有很多成熟的漏洞扫描工具和安全审计工具可供选择,例如Burp Suite、Nessus等。在选择时,我们应该综合考虑工具的功能、适用范围、易用性和维护更新等因素,选择最适合自己需求的检测工具。
其次,规范化代码开发和安全审查也是有效检测批量反序列化漏洞的重要方法。合理约束程序员在开发过程中的代码编写和反序列化操作,使用安全的序列化/反序列化库,以减少潜在的漏洞;同时,进行定期的代码审查,发现和修复存在的漏洞。
再次,强化网络防火墙和入侵监测系统。网络防火墙可以监视和过滤网络流量,阻止恶意序列化数据包进入系统;而入侵监测系统可以及时发现并报警在系统中进行的异常序列化操作。
最后,定期更新和升级系统及相关组件,及时修补已知的漏洞。软件和系统的漏洞是黑客攻击的入口之一,只有及时修复这些漏洞,才能有效防范批量反序列化漏洞的攻击。
总结起来,批量反序列化漏洞是一种常见且危险的安全漏洞,对网络安全带来了很大威胁。为了保障网络安全,我们需要采取有效的漏洞检测措施,如选择合适的检测工具、规范代码开发和安全审查、强化防火墙和入侵监测系统以及定期更新升级系统等。只有确保系统的整体安全性,我们才能更好地应对批量反序列化漏洞带来的风险,保护我们的网络安全。
注:本文所提到的漏洞检测方法和安全措施仅供参考,请在实际使用中遵循相关法律法规,并根据自身需求和实际情况合理选择和使用相关工具和措施。